Brewed by Fyne Ales
Style: Golden Ale/Blond Ale

Cairndow, Argyll, Scotland

Commercial Description:
Cask, Special;
Special brew to commemorate the island where all the Dukes of Argyll are burried.

(Cask by gravity at Bree Louise, Euston, London, 16 Apr 2009) Pale golden colour with brief, white head. Fruity, hoppy nose with grass, citrus peel and citrussy hops. Fruity, hoppy taste with notes of lemon, grass and generous doses of fresh hops. Light body, fairly dry. Fresh, hoppy and nice golden ale.

Cask at Abbostford, Edinburgh. A golden beer with a slight haze under a thin lazing off-white head. The aroma is sweet with flowery hoppy notes. The flavor is sweet with light notes of malt and notes of flowery hops, elderberryflowers, and grass, leading to a dry and nicely bitter finish. The body is thin.

A cask ale for the hopheads this one. A flowery, peppery, spicy and very mineral golden ale. Clear and wearing a fair white head that slowly fades. Interesting palate has a rather crisp bite for a cask offering. Floral and efficient cutting bitter finish. Light limey and watermelon-like salted cracker notes. Good stuff.
